With Microsoft Windows 7; the built in-firewall in amazing. And you can easily control all the incoming/outgoing traffic; so I don’t believe that you will need a third party software to cover the firewall part. The Firewall Feature from Microsoft was introduced in windows XP SP2 and there was a very big enhancement in Microsoft Windows Vista then Microsoft Windows 7. Personaly I stopped using Firewall Software (3rd Party since Windows Vista).
Concerning the antivirus; if you want to work legal; I would like to recommend the following software: Microsoft Security Essentials; it is free and you will get update through Windows Updates.

Microsoft has the pleasure to announce that Forefront Threat Management Gateway (TMG) 2010 was released to manufacturing this week (Nov 16th, 2009) after completing 3 Beta releases and receiving extensive customer feedback. The trial version is available for download today, and the product will be widely available for purchase soon.
Microsoft encourage you to download the new release and evaluate it in your environment. Forefront TMG provides an unparalleled value to the network security marketplace by integrating multiple web security technologies into a single, comprehensive solution. Forefront TMG is also all about “the basics” to ensure that besides the breadth of new features, Forefront TMG also provides the best infrastructure to run those features: reliability, scalability, performance and security.
In the following sections I will list some of the new functionality that Microsoft has added into TMG and will cover some of our infrastructure investments.
·Secure Web Gateway: Forefront TMG is a Secure Web Gateway (SWG) that improves security enforcement by integrating multiple detection technologies such as URL filtering, Anti Malware, and intrusion prevention into a single, easy-to-manage solution. Microsoft has seen a lot of interest in the features that comprise this solution, so here is some information on what they do and how:
oURL Filtering: URL Filtering allows controlling end-user access to Web sites, protecting the organization by denying access to known malicious sites and to sites displaying inappropriate or nonproductive materials, based on URL categories. TMG features over 80 URL categories including security-oriented categories, productivity-oriented and liability-oriented categories. Forefront TMG uses Microsoft Reputation Services (MRS), a cloud-based categorization system hosted in Microsoft data center. To ensure the best bandwidth utilization and low latency, Forefront TMG has implemented a local URL cache. There is a lot more on URL Filtering available in an earlier URL Filtering post.
oAnti Malware: Stopping malware on the edge significantly decreases the possibility that a virus will hit a computer with anti-virus signatures that are not up-to-date or a test computer without an anti-virus to protect it. TMG has integrated the Microsoft Anti Malware engine to provide world class scanning and blocking capability on the edge.
oNetwork Inspection System (NIS): NIS is a generic application protocol decode-based traffic inspection system that uses signatures of known vulnerabilities, to detect and potentially block attacks on network resources. NIS provides comprehensive protection for Microsoft network vulnerabilities, researched and developed by the Microsoft Malware Protection Center - NIS Response Team, as well as an operational signature distribution channel which enables dynamic signature snapshot distribution. NIS closes the vulnerability window between vulnerability disclosures and patch deployment from weeks to few hours.
In addition, Microsoft has introduced HTTPS scanning to enable inspection of encrypted sessions, eased the deployment and management with a set of easy to use wizards and significantly improved logging and reporting to provide full visibility into how your organization is accessing the web and whether it’s compliant with your organization’s policy.
·VPN, Firewall, Email Protection and Infrastructure:
Microsoft has also made significant investments to ensure that we keep delivering top notch VPN and Firewall functionality. Microsoft made quality improvements in Web Caching and made sure it works well with the new Windows 7 BranchCache feature. Microsoft have added several new features, among them: Email Protection, ISP redundancy, NAP integration with VPN role, SSTP, VoIP traversal (SIP support), Enhanced NAT, SQL logging and Updated TMG Client (previously known as the Firewall Client). In addition TMG was built as a native 64bit product that supports Windows Server 2008 R2, and Windows Server 2008 SP2, allowing better scalability and increased reliability.

That is one of the greatest problems that we are facing nowadays
specially in Egypt due that we don’t following the standards for mailing
system in Egypt. You can face companies in Egypt that are using DSL for Home to
send email; also they don’t configure their firewall to only allow the
mail system to connect through port 25 which cause that users can be affected
by Virus and spreading spam emails from the Organization network to the
internet.
In general; each SMTP gateway responsible of sending emails
should have a PTR and any emails systems should be configured to not accept any
email from domain without checking its PTR. Also as best practices; each
domains should have a SPF Records in its DNS Zones.
Also you can make the IP that is used for Exchange (sending/receiving
emails) different from the IP address used for browsing and other services.
In Microsoft Exchange Server 2007; there is a role name Edge
Server that is acting at the SMTP Gateway; this server is responsible of
send/receive all the emails of Organization on the Internet. You can
configure the Edge to filter the incoming emails. If you don’t have the
Edge; you can enable these features on the edge as they are not enabled by
default.

Dears
I
remarked nowadays that a lot of emails are sent to users about Microsoft
Updates and require from them to download a critical update and install it. So
to Avoid this kind of emails; please notify your users to not follow this kind
of emails. The link sent in the email is hiding another URL not from Microsoft
but another site. This link can install any malware on the PC of your
workstation or steal their private Information.

One
of the biggest issues that Microsoft Exchange Server 2007 Administrators are
facing is: Where is the Whitelist in Microsoft Exchange Server 2007?
Whitelists
are common in most 3rd-party anti-spam tools. Adding domains or SMTP addresses
of important senders like customers, vendors, or your CEO's home email
address for instance, ensures messages from these domains or addresses do
not get filtered by the anti-spam filter.
When
you browse the different options of Mail Flittering on the Edge Server or the
HUB Server; you will not find this tab; so how can we manage our Whitelists?
The
good news is Microsoft Exchange Server 2007's Content Filter Agent has
whitelists! You can add SMTP addresses and domains to the Content Filter
configuration, and have messages from these senders and domains bypass the
Content Filter Agent. However, you need to resort to the Exchange shell (EMS)
to manage it.

Before
you start using whitelists, here are a few things you should consider:
SMTP
headers can be spoofed easily. If spammers spoof any of the addresses or
domains you whitelist, your recipients may end up getting more spam as all of
it will bypass the Content Filter.
Use
SenderID Filtering to detect and protect your mail system from header spoofing.
Maintaining whitelists, just as maintaining blacklists, is a manual process
that imposes its own management costs.
Checking
every inbound message against a list of whitelisted recipients imposes a
performance penalty - miniscule as it may be. Use the whitelists sparingly.
